Ordinals
beta
Address bc1qk3644uhweetht4grnd0wtanyruf20eg4mqk23y
sat balance
22848741
runes balances
outputs
89bb09d6923533a4a935ebe2c63b45d202150582568c4d96e160147315577c9b:0
2ddbf330cbfee278651a0a3fcfacc4a3e7676a92be39aad69e3764eb77832bd2:18